BMA Biomedicals
Swiss Precision to Drive Global Immunoassay Innovation Excellence

BMA Biomedicals

Sonia Accossato, BMA Biomedicals | Life Science Review | Top Swiss Biotech CompaniesSonia Accossato, Senior Scientist and Business Development
BMA Biomedicals, based in Switzerland, specializes in manufacturing high-quality immunoassays and antibodies, providing researchers with a comprehensive toolkit to support diverse in vitro research needs. These products are thoroughly crafted to uphold the ‘Swiss-made’ standards of quality and reliability, ensuring consistent performance in critical scientific investigations.

Serving a wide range of research areas—including metabolism, inflammation, infectious diseases, hemostasis, tumor diseases and veterinary science—BMA Biomedicals’ offerings are designed to cater to the complex demands of the scientific community. This versatility makes them a trusted resource for researchers across multiple fields of study.

Among its offerings, BMA’s calprotectin ELISA assay empowers researchers to precisely measure this key inflammatory marker in biological fluids, aiding in diagnosing and monitoring inflammatory diseases like Crohn's.

To quantify semaglutide, a peptide of significant interest in diabetes and weight loss research, BMA developed an ELISA kit that has garnered positive feedback from satisfied customers.

“For over 35 years, we have refined our approach by actively engaging with researchers and fostering collaborative partnerships beyond the traditional supplier-client relationship,” says Sonia Accossato, senior scientist and business development.

BMA is also dedicated to ethical and sustainable practices, as demonstrated by its use of fetal calf serum-free culture media in monoclonal antibody production. This method prioritizes animal welfare, enhances experimental reproducibility and reduces contamination risks, resulting in more consistent and reliable outcomes for researchers.

Its monoclonal antibodies, derived from porcine tissues, support the expanding use of the porcine model in transplantation, toxicology, pharmacology and stem cell therapies, enabling researchers to address critical medical challenges and explore new therapeutic avenues.

Cutting-edge technologies, including hybridoma and single B cell techniques, are used to produce high-quality, consistent monoclonal antibodies. BMA is now exploring the potential of AI in antibody design to enhance precision, speed and cost-effectiveness, providing researchers with advanced tools more rapidly and at potentially lower costs.
